The following question is based on multiple solids. Remember to identify the shared feature of the two shapes to solve the problem.

Select the correct answer and then click Continue.

A cylinder has a volume of 320 cubic cm and a radius of 4 cm. What is the greatest number of spheres of radius 3.5 cm that the cylinder can hold?

1
2
3
4
5
